请稍侯

memory的访问速度比较

  首先上一张图,图中各个部件的价格可能和现在差距比较大,但是我们主要关注的是访问速度。   我们知道,cpu只能和register(寄存器)进行数据的交互,寄存的意思就是是暂时存放数据,不用每次从内存中读取,是一个临时放数据的空间。寄存器中的数据来自于ram(内存)。所以信息之间的交换为:...

如何使用GDB调试程序

   GDB是什么   GDB是GNU开源组织发布的一个linux 系统上常用的 c/c++ 调试工具。之前工作环境一直在windows下,所以对图形化的调试方法比较熟悉,开始接触GDB的时候,觉得这样的调试方法简直“不可思议”,但是现在用下来觉得有点地方还是比图形化的调试更强大一点。GD...

void和void*

  测试环境:win7下使用VS2010 和 ubuntu 12.04.3下使用gcc编译运行程序   void的字面意思是“无类型”,void不可以用来定义变量,这一点两个cl编译器和gcc编译器编译规则都做了限制,编译时都会给出error。仔细一想,使用void定义一个无类型的数据也没有...

宏里面的do {...} while (0)

  原文链接:http://www.pixelstech.net/article/1390482950-do-%7B-%7D-while-%280%29-in-macros   如果你是一个C程序员,想必你一定会对宏很熟悉。它们威力无穷,如果使用得当可以很大程度简化我们的工作。但是,...

如何调用豆瓣API

  最近在自己的网页中希望可以输入书籍的ISBN号就可以自动补全书籍的所有信息,人工输入工作量太大,就选择了调用豆瓣的API获得数据填写到表单中。做了两天才做好,网上有用的资料比较少,于是晒出自己这两天做的一些东西,希望可以帮助到需要的人,注意:APIV1.0和2.0是有区别的。在下面有提到,...

蛤蟆的油

  寒假回来之前,去图书馆借了几本书回来看看。一本是菲茨杰拉德的《了不起的盖茨比》,还有一本是黑泽明的自传《蛤蟆的油》。想看《了不起的盖茨比》是因为前一阵子看了电影才知道的这本书。而另外一本是日本著名电影导演黑泽明老师的自传《蛤蟆的油》。   一开始看到这本书时还在纳闷为什么会叫...

自动登录网关的python脚本

摘要 :   这篇文章主要介绍如何使用python编写登陆苏州大学网关的脚本。该脚本每隔一秒检测网络是否连接,如果没有联网就会自动登陆网关,若网络没有断开则继续判断 1 准备工作 1.1 工作原理   首先我们先分析一下我们登陆网关的流程是怎么样的。当我们打开wg.suda.edu.c...

Hello World这件“小事”

前言   学过编程的人对于hello world一定不陌生,每当接触一门语言时,我们总会从这个简单却又让人兴奋不已的例子开始,也正是这么一个只有一行或者几行的代码带领了无数的人走进了编程的世界。   在平常的程序开发中,大多数人都是使用的IDE进行开发,比如Visual Studio、E...

使用Github搭建自己的博客

1 搭建环境 操作系统:Windows 7旗舰版64位 2 基础知识和准备工作   Git 是一个开源的分布式版本控制系统,用以有效、高速的处理从很小到非常大的项目版本管理。Git 是 Linus Torvalds 为了帮助管理 Linux 内核开发而开发的一个开放源码的版...

校园一瞥

  苏大的同学应该认识这是哪里。。。吧。。。   话说一张照片作为一篇博客是不是太奢侈了!